Common use of The Interconnection Point Clause in Contracts

The Interconnection Point. 3.1 The Customer is entitled pursuant to this Agreement to use for withdrawal of natural gas from the Storage Facility the Interconnection Point with [MISSING DATA TO BE INSERTED]. The Customer is entitled pursuant to this Agreement to use for injection of natural gas into the Storage Facility the Interconnection Point with [MISSING DATA TO BE INSERTED]. The withdrawal and injection of natural gas shall be governed by the Rules of Operation (the Article 8) and the Technical Conditions. 3.2 If the use of the Storage Services by the Customer leads to fees for the cross-border use of storage facilities pursuant to the valid E-Control Regulation Commission Ordinance setting the Natural Gas System Charges (Gas System Charges Ordinance 2013) as may be amended from time to time, these fees shall be paid by the Customer.
